The Early Childhood Development Virtual University (ECDVU) in a training program for teachers who work in early childhood programs in Africa.  The university meets the needs of the teachers in Africa by offering many ways to get instruction including, “residential seminars, web-based instruction, CD-Rom and print material support, and a 'community of learners' strategy within and among cohort countries” (http://www.ecdvu.org/ssa/index.php). 

The ECDVU encourages learners to work within their communities to help address early childhood issues throughout Africa.  They do this through a generative approach, that I though was very interesting.  This approach creates communities of professionals that work together in their communities as well as networking across cultures and countries.
